Review of Malabar College of Engineering & Technology, Wadakancherry.
Placements: Placements in our college are not good, and amount of students recruited is about 50-60%. The basic stipend offered in the year 2019 was Rs. 5000, and it all the way goes up to Rs. 25000. The placements are mostly based on just marks, students with good marks can get placements, but the starting package will be poor. Google & Siemen's visited the campus from the final year for recruitment.
Infrastructure: It normally looks like a better college. The authorities of college provide good infrastructure like ensure of labs, classrooms, a library also but the Wi-Fi facility is very bad. But hostel facilities are good for ladies and gents. During our course, the authority provided first year 200 students a hostel.
Faculty: Teachers are highly qualified. They help us to maintain our level of study. They teach better and give good messages for the living. They help students to upgrade. This course gives more benefits in different ways. Semester exams are moderately tough.
Other: I opted for this course because I like it. This course has more job vacancies in our country and foreign countries. The labs are more helpful in improving skills. The practical sections are of much benefit. The other programs like fest, etc. are also held.

Review of Malabar College of Engineering & Technology, Wadakancherry.
Placements: Our college doesn't have applaudable placements. Google conducted a workshop. Siemens visits here for placements for civil engineering students. Automobile companies visited here, and many of them were service centres. The stipend offered will start from Rs. 5,000 per month to around Rs. 20,000 per month.
Infrastructure: The boys' hostel at MCET College renders distinct hostel amenities for first-year students, and it can provide accommodation for more than 200 students. At most, a maximum of three students are allotted to every room. Separations are provided for reading rooms on each floor, which are partitioned from a common room available to enjoy television.
Faculty: The curriculum needs to be updated here. They need to add more practical sessions. The theory subject we had studied was very old. We need to improve our current knowledge by updating the subjects. The exams structure is good and feasible, but sometimes they do not inform us about the dates of the fees to be paid. So it may cause inconvenience, and there are also some other fees like exam fee, semester registration fee, etc. If we consider all these fees once, it may be expensive.
Other: I only have positive thoughts about our campus. The campus helped me to remove my pre-occupation, inhibitions, fear, etc. It gave a lot of memorable moments and a huge number of friends. The most special thing about the college is that memorable friendship with the faculty members who understand students very well.

Malabar engineering college, overall review.
Placements: The placement cell is working inside the college campus. Many years number of placed students is about 100. The college provides placement according to marks obtained by students. If you fail in any exam you have a very less chance to get a placement from college. You will find many job opportunities for mechanical engineering. The internship is not provided by the college.
Infrastructure: Boy's hostel at the college renders distinct hostel amenities for the first-year students can sustain more than 200 students. At most, a maximum of three members is allocated to each room. Girls hostel at the college is provided exquisite amenities inside the college campus. The ladies hostel can have a room for more than 400 students. The hostel is allotted with luxurious mess halls and study halls. The classrooms are very hygienic. There is a badminton court, football ground and table tennis on the campus.
Faculty: There are well qualified friendly and very interested in teaching. Almost every faculty does not cover the entire syllabus. They will take classes without considering the student's doubts. Teachers have good knowledge in the perspective subjects as well as a good teaching skill. The course is based on ktu university. There are 8 semesters and a written exams at the end of the semester. If you fail in any exam you can repeat it 4 times. And if you fail in all attempts you will fail in the course.
Other: Fees are less compared to other colleges. If you don't pay fees on time you will get kicked out of class with no consideration at all. They are very strict on fees. There are many college events Like arts, sports, tech fest, Onam celebrations, college day, student union day.
